Oregon Hill (M. Timmins/Cowboy Junkies) (from the album Black Eyed Man) Submitted by Steve Scowden ([email protected]) Corrections/improvements welcome. (I'm playing this song with a Em E6 -E7 riff through most of the verses. That is, an E, then an E with my pinkie added on 2nd fret of 2nd string, then sliding my pinkie up to the 3rd fret. Of course, there may be a better way.)
